Heat exhaustion easier in high school than the NFL

Right now, it's easier to become a casualty of the record-breaking heat if you're involved in high school sports than if you play sorts for a living.

The NFL has announced an end to "two-a-days," or twice-daily practice sessions.

In the world of Texas high school football, there's no such ban. School districts are free to determine what they think is safe.

Right now, the districts I have seen are "exercising caution" and allowing coaches to determine what's safe. If you think that's effective, go Google "football death" — even a coach died recently.
